John Simpson: Waived by Las Vegas
Simpson was waived by the Raiders on Saturday, Tom Pelissero of NFL Network reports. Simpson, a fourth-round pick in the 2020 NFL Draft, started every game for the Raiders in 2021. However, he has primarily played a reserve role this year. He will be a candidate to land with a contender in need of offensive line help via waivers.... See More ... See Less -
Raiders' John Simpson: Suits up Thursday
Simpson (ribs) is listed as active for Thursday's game against the Cowboys. Simpson approached the contest viewed as a game-time decision, but he'll be available Thursday and thus is slated to handle his starting left guard duties Week 12.... See More ... See Less -
Raiders' John Simpson: Dealing with rib injury
Simpson (ribs) is questionable to return Sunday against the Bengals. Simpson has started every game this season at left guard, so his absence would be a big blow to the Raiders' offensive line. If he is unable to return, Jordan Simmons will likely replace him for the remainder of the contest.... See More ... See Less -
